Pharmaceutical science is the practice of creating drugs. The field draws from a wide range of other sciences, including mathematics, chemical engineering, and biology.
This course begins by studying chemistry, biology, physics, technology, and statistics for the first two years. Students then specialise in either traditional pharmaceutics or biopharmaceutics.
Careers or Further Progression...
Careers in range of production environments in the pharmaceutical industry in areas of Pharmaceutical Manufacturing Technology, Biopharmaceutical Technology, Validation, Calibration, Quality Control, Health and Safety, Management and Industry Regulation.
